The nutrients needed for lotus root growth and development come from the photosynthesis of lotus leaves; on the other hand, they come from the soil, while the original fertilizer in the soil is limited (including the base fertilizer), and it will grow more and more as the plant grows and develops. Less, so it is necessary to topdress in time.

First, the need for fertilizer characteristics

Lotus root is a high-efficiency economic crop with expanded underground rhizomes as the main product, and it is also a crop with a large amount of fertilizer. Generally, the lotus root per acre absorbs about 7.7 kg of pure nitrogen, 3.0 kg of pure phosphorus and 11.4 kg of pure potassium. The absorption ratio of pure nutrients of lotus root to NPK is about 2:1:3.

Second, fertilization technology

1. Apply enough base fertilizer

The base fertilizer can supply the nutrients needed for the whole growth period of the lotus root, create good soil conditions for its growth and development, and have the functions of improving the soil and fertilizing the soil. The application amount of the base fertilizer in Putian should be determined according to the soil fertility. Generally, the soil is loose, fertile, rich in organic matter, convenient for irrigation and drainage, combined with 2500-3000 kg of decomposed organic fertilizer per mu, and the right-way general-purpose compound fertilizer. 60 to 80 kg, and apply calcium, boron, zinc and other micro-fertilizers.

2, reasonable topdressing

Lotus roots topdressed 3 times during the whole growth period. The first time is applied in 1 to 2 leaves (about 25 to 30 days), combined with cultivating and weeding, applying 750-1000 kg of human excrement per acre or 25-30 kg of normal high-nitrogen compound fertilizer; Apply 5 to 6 pieces of lobes (40 to 50 days after planting, that is, when the line is closed), and apply 30 to 35 kg of high-nitrogen and high-potassium compound fertilizer per acre; the third top dressing is carried out when the terminal leaves appear. At this time, the beginning of the crusting, that is, chasing the fat, 15 to 20 kg of high-potassium compound fertilizer per acre.

In shallow water, the field should be fertilized in sunny and windless weather, avoiding noon in the hot sun, releasing water before fertilization, fertilizing in shallow water, and re-watering to restore the water layer 2 days after fertilization. In order to prevent the fertilizer from floating, it should be made into a fat mud group.
